Understanding Delta Before You Delta Airline Book Flight
Delta Air Lines is head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ia and operates its largest hub at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port. Understanding Delta’s network helps you make smarter decisions before completing your delta airline flights booking.
Delta’s major US hubs are Atlanta, New York JFK, New York LaGuardia, Los Angeles, Seattle, Minneapolis, Detroit, Salt Lake City, and Boston. Routing your delta airline flights booking through one of these hubs gives you the most connection options and often the lowest available fares.
Delta is a member of the SkyTeam alliance. Miles earned on delta airline book flight can also be redeemed on partner airlines including Air France, KLM, and Korean Air. Enroll free in SkyMiles at delta.com/skymiles before your next flight booking.
Delta Fare Classes for Delta Airline Flights Booking
Choosing the wrong fare class is the most expensive mistake travelers make when they delta airline book flight. Here is what each class includes.
Basic Economy
Delta’s lowest available fare. Includes a personal item and carry-on bag but does not allow changes, cancellations, or advance seat selection. Seat is assigned automatically at check-in. Only choose Basic Economy when your plans are completely fixed and certain.
Main Cabin
The standard ticket and the right choice for most travelers completing delta airline flights booking. Includes seat selection, carry-on bag, and the ability to change your ticket with no change fee — you pay only any fare difference.
Delta Comfort Plus
Offers 3 to 4 extra inches of legroom, priority boarding, and complimentary snacks and drinks on domestic routes. Costs $15 to $80 more than Main Cabin. Worth considering on any flight over 3 hours when you delta airline book flight.
First Class Domestic
Wide reclining seats, priority boarding, upgraded meals and drinks, and 2 free checked bags. On many domestic routes First Class costs only $80 to $150 more than economy — a meaningful comfort improvement on longer flights.
Delta Premium Select
Available on select international routes. Offers a wider seat with more recline than economy, enhanced meals, and priority service throughout your delta airline flights booking.
Delta One Business Class
Delta’s international Business Class product. Features a fully lie-flat bed, direct aisle access, lounge access, premium dining, and priority service. For flights over 7 hours the comfort difference is significant.

Delta Airline Flights Booking — Baggage Policy
Personal Item
A small bag fitting under the seat in front of you is free on all Delta fare classes including Basic Economy.
Carry-On Bag
A standard carry-on bag for the overhead bin is free on all Delta fare classes.
Checked Baggage Fees
First checked bag — $35 each way on Basic Economy and Main Cabin. Free on First Class, Delta One, and for Platinum, Gold, and Diamond Medallion members.
Second checked bag — $45 each way on Main Cabin. Free on First Class and Delta One.
Bags over 50 pounds — $100 overweight fee each way.
Bags over 62 total linear inches — $200 oversized fee.

Delta SkyMiles — Earn on Every Flight Booking
Every delta airline book flight earns SkyMiles based on the amount paid and your membership level.
General members earn 5 miles per dollar spent on delta airline flights booking. Silver Medallion earns 7 miles per dollar. Gold Medallion earns 8 miles per dollar. Platinum Medallion earns 9 miles per dollar. Diamond Medallion — Delta’s highest status — earns 11 miles per dollar spent on every flight reservation.
SkyMiles never expire. Redeem them for free award flights, seat upgrades, in-flight purchases, and hotel stays through Delta’s travel partners. Enroll free at delta.com/skymiles.
To use SkyMiles for your next delta airline book flight log in to your account, toggle Shop with Miles in the search, and award fares display in miles instead of dollars.

How to Cancel Your Booking
Go to delta.com, click My Trips, find your reservation, and select Cancel Flight. You receive a travel eCredit valid for 1 year toward any future delta airline book flight. Basic Economy tickets cannot be cancelled after the 24-hour risk-free window has passed.
Under US Department of Transportation rules — explained at transportation.gov/airconsumer — when Delta cancels your flight you are entitled to a full cash refund regardless of fare class. Read our complete airline cancellation and change guide for full details on your passenger rights.
